I. Route Features of Xinjiang Tourism Special Trains: One Train, One Scenery, Connecting the Highlights of Northern and Southern Xinjiang
The Xinjiang tourism special train starts from Urumqi and operates in a loop, covering core attractions in northern and southern Xinjiang such as Tianchi, Kanas, Sayram Lake, Nalati Grassland, and Kashgar Old Town. Based on differences in carriage configurations and services, the current mainstream special trains are divided into the following three categories:
[Luxury-Type Special Train:Kunlun Train]
Carriage Configuration: The entire train consists of 8 sleeper carriages, offering various room types including four-person upper and lower soft sleepers (with desks and shared bathrooms), two-person upper and lower soft sleepers (with desks and shared bathrooms), two-person lower soft sleepers (shared bathrooms), and single-room flat soft sleepers (with washrooms). The soft furnishings incorporate the folk customs of various ethnic groups.
Route Features:Connecting core attractions in eastern, southern, and northern Xinjiang, the 14-day itinerary covers Turpan, Kuqa, Kashgar, Nalati, Sayram Lake, Kanas, and other places, with an average of 6-8 hours of daily sightseeing, reserved lunch and rest time at noon, and night travel to ensure sufficient sleep.
Service Highlights:On-board medical support, professional tour guide explanations, Xinjiang specialty meals (pilaf, big plate chicken, baked buns, etc.), with a meal standard of approximately 50-80 yuan per person per meal.
[Panoramic-Type Special Train:Tianshan Train]
Carriage Configuration:Blue Diamond Series (7 four-person compartments with shared bathrooms) and Silver Diamond Series (en-suite king suites, presidential single rooms, etc.), equipped with a bar carriage and a multi-functional leisure carriage (including a children’s entertainment area, booth seating area, and health and wellness massage area).
Route Features: The 12-day, 11-night itinerary connects attractions such as Tianchi, Beitun, Kanas, Hemu Village, Sayram Lake, Yining, Nalati Grassland, Bayanbulak Grassland, the Duoku Road, the Tianshan Secret Grand Canyon, Kashgar, and the Pamir Plateau, covering natural landscapes in northern Xinjiang and cultural landscapes in southern Xinjiang.
Service Highlights:An all-inclusive pricing model covering specified items in the itinerary, including special train accommodation, hotel accommodation, attraction tickets, ground transportation, tour guide services, and travel accident insurance. Organizes folk experience activities such as home visits to various ethnic groups and Tuwa families.

Carriage Configuration:Decorated with the theme of Hunan culture, it provides comfortable soft sleeper carriages equipped with bathroom facilities.
Route Features:Customized for middle-aged and elderly groups, the 14-day itinerary focuses on ‘health and leisure,’ connecting the highlights of northern and southern Xinjiang with a gentle pace and an average daily travel time controlled within 3-4 hours.
Service Highlights:Provides age-friendly services throughout the journey, such as elevator-equipped hotels, easily digestible dishes, emergency medical support, etc. Organizes cultural activities such as folk song and dance performances by various ethnic groups and intangible cultural heritage handicraft experiences.

III. Pricing Explanation: Significant Room Type Differences, Subject to Contract Confirmation
The prices of Xinjiang tourism special trains vary depending on the train model, room type, and departure date. The reference price range for 2026 is as follows:
Kunlun Train Price Reference
Four-Person Compartment (Shared Bathroom):Upper bunk 14,800 yuan per person, lower bunk 15,800 yuan per person (May departures); upper bunk 15,800 yuan per person, lower bunk 16,800 yuan per person (June-September departures)
Two-Person Compartment (Shared Bathroom):Upper bunk 17,800 yuan per person, lower bunk 18,800 yuan per person (May departures); upper bunk 18,800 yuan per person, lower bunk 19,800 yuan per person (June-September departures)
Two-Person Compartment (Private Bathroom):Upper bunk 22,800 yuan per person, lower bunk 23,800 yuan per person (May departures); upper bunk 23,800 yuan per person, lower bunk 24,800 yuan per person (June-September departures)
Single Room (Private Bathroom):38,800 yuan per person (May departures); 39,800 yuan per person (June-September departures)

VI. Precautions
Document Preparation:Valid identification documents are required for travel. Children need to bring their household registration books.
Health Requirements:The special train itinerary involves an average of approximately 5,000-8,000 steps of walking per day. It is recommended to choose an appropriate route based on your health condition.
Policy Changes:The ticket policies for Xinjiang attractions may change. The final policy is subject to the announcement by the attractions.
